Lemon Chickpea Pita Wraps

These wraps are a healthy and tasty vegan meal that you can make in less than 30 minutes. They have no oil or gluten, but plenty of protein, fiber, and antioxidants from the chickpeas, lemon, and tahini. These ingredients also support your blood, energy, bone, gut, immune, heart, and skin health. The pitas are made from whole wheat flour, which provides complex carbs and fiber for your brain and digestion. The wraps are also filled with fresh lettuce, cucumber, and pickled onions for some crunch and freshness. The flavors and textures are amazing and satisfying.

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• In a small bowl; whisk together the garlic; juice and zest of the lemon; maple syrup; soy sauce or coconut aminos; hot sauce and avocado oil. This is the sticky lemon sauce.
  • In a large bowl
  • toss the chickpeas with half of the sticky lemon sauce until well coated.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  • Spread the chickpeas in an even layer on the prepared baking sheet and bake for 20 minutes or until crispy and golden.
  • In another small bowl; whisk together the parsley; yogurt; tahini; salt and pepper to taste. This is the tahini yogurt sauce.
  • To assemble the wraps warm up the pitas in a microwave or oven until soft. Cut them in half and open up each pocket.
  • Fill each pita pocket with some lettuce; cucumber slices; pickled onions (if using); sticky lemon chickpeas and tahini yogurt sauce.

  • Variations:
  • You can use any beans you like instead of chickpeas such as black beans; kidney beans or white beans.
  • You can use any herbs you like instead of parsley for the tahini yogurt sauce such as cilantro; mint or basil.
  • You can use any spices you like instead of salt and pepper for seasoning the chickpeas or the sauce such as cumin; paprika
  • turmeric or curry powder.
  • You can use any sauces you like instead of hot sauce for adding some heat to the sticky lemon sauce such as sriracha; chili garlic sauce or harissa.

  • Tips:
  • You can store the leftover chickpeas and sauce in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. You can reheat them in a microwave or oven before assembling the wraps.
  • You can serve the wraps with some fresh fruit; salad or hummus for a complete and balanced meal.
  • You can adjust the amount of maple syrup or hot sauce in the sticky lemon sauce according to your taste preference. You can also add some water to thin out the sauce if it is too thick.
